In this episode of "Building Green: Tomorrow’s Architecture Today," our host, Ladina Schöpf, sits down with Akbar Hassan, not an architect, but Senior Investment Analyst at Kettler, to explore the intersection of real estate finance and sustainable architecture. 

Akbar shares his journey from his beginnings at New York University to his role at Kettler, through very different touchpoints with sustainable architecture. He brings to light how incorporating sustainable practices in building and investment not only reduces carbon footprints, but also enhances economic value.
